Nutrition Facts per 100g
| Water | 86.7 | G |
| Energy | 42.0 | KCAL |
| Protein | 3.6 | G |
| Total lipid (fat) | 0.39 | G |
| Carbohydrate, by difference | 8.3 | G |
| Fiber, total dietary | 4.1 | G |
| Total Sugars | 2.1 | G |
| Cholesterol | 0 | MG |
| Vitamin C, total ascorbic acid | 45.7 | MG |
| Thiamin | 0.10 | MG |
| Riboflavin | 0.11 | MG |
| Niacin | 0.54 | MG |
| Vitamin B-6 | 0.29 | MG |
| Folate, total | 101 | UG |
| Vitamin B-12 | 0 | UG |
| Vitamin A, RAE | 46.0 | UG |
| Vitamin E (alpha-tocopherol) | 0.51 | MG |
| Vitamin D (D2 + D3) | 0 | UG |
| Vitamin K (phylloquinone) | 194 | UG |
| Calcium, Ca | 26.0 | MG |
| Iron, Fe | 0.48 | MG |
| Magnesium, Mg | 18.0 | MG |
| Phosphorus, P | 56.0 | MG |
| Potassium, K | 290 | MG |
| Sodium, Na | 259 | MG |
| Zinc, Zn | 0.24 | MG |
| Copper, Cu | 0.03 | MG |
| Manganese, Mn | 0.21 | MG |
| Selenium, Se | 0.60 | UG |
